Transaction 18e171391cdf95b707f751ca2a152d507b1ddfc963b69520876ae93e7f7f10ec

1 Input
2 Outputs
  • 18e171391cdf95b707f751ca2a152d507b1ddfc963b69520876ae93e7f7f10ec:0
  • value  382266
    address  3LQrJ2jyqdQvWrT8AV3jnDvAWvAaWSUBH4
  • 18e171391cdf95b707f751ca2a152d507b1ddfc963b69520876ae93e7f7f10ec:1
  • value  4844711
    address  3E1gqvK6kR51xEAmmrri61hpoQW7crdJ6H